Waffles - Basic, low-carb
Ingredients
- 6 ounces Cream cheese softened
- 5 Eggs
- 1/4 cup Whey protein powder
- 1 teaspoon Baking soda
- 1/2 teaspoon Cream of tartar
- 1 1/4 cup Whole almond meal
- 1/4 cup Whey protein powder
- 1/4 cup Heavy cream
- 1 teaspoon Vanilla
Instructions
- NOTE: recipe calls for 1/2 whey protein powder. Original 1/4 caup was to have been soy protein powder.
- *For slightly lighter waffles, separate three of the five eggs. Add the yolks along with the whole eggs and beat the three egg whites. Fold in last..
- In an electric mixer, food processor, or by hand, beat the cream cheese and two eggs until smooth, thick and fluffy. Add the remaining three eggs, one at a time, beating briefly after each addition. Stir
- the protein , baking soda, cream of tartar, almond meal, and heavy cream into the batter by hand or at slow mixer speed.
- Spoon batter into the waffle iron. Bake until done (generally from 2 to 4 minutes. Always chec early. The waffles are delicate, so remove them carefully. Do not pile them on top of one another or
- they may become soggy. You can freeze leftover waffles and heat them in a toaster (thaw first).
